Project a professional image always.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S Assists in interpretation of nursing policies and ensures appropriate implementation. Directs and enforces policies and procedures with staff, families, and visitors. Supervises and coordinates activities of nursing personnel on assigned shift to maintain continuity of nursing care. Resource in all areas of clinical care and resolves work related complaints of charge nurses and CNA's during assigned shift. Makes rounds on nursing units to ensure maximum care and to ascertain condition of residents. Communicates family concerns. Responds to emergencies within the facility and provides medical oversight. Verifies that all clinical changes are reported to the physician. Verifies physicians’ orders as needed. Secures pre-admission report on new residents. Ensures a safe environment for residents and staff. Ensures all documentation on medical record is complete and is accurate (including A & I’s; 24 Hour Nursing Report; Nursing Assessments; MD Orders; documentation involving Admissions, discharges, deaths, and Transfers). Conducts chart audits. Ensures availability of supplies and equipment. Reports malfunctioning equipment to DNS/ADNS. Follows up with the physician and medical director as necessary to ensure compliance with scheduled visits. Assumes supervisor responsibility for the facility on 2nd and/or 3rd shifts and/or weekends. Audits emergency drug cart and crash cart to assure they are properly stocked. Audits control of drugs and counts controlled medications at the beginning and end of each shift. Ensures that all peripheral IVs are initiated per facility policy and monitors overall IV program. Ensures IV policy is updated annually. Responsible to assign nursing personnel in emergencies to maintain patient care hours. Assists in the recruitment, selection and of orientation nursing staff as needed. If facility directed, completes 90-day and annual employee performance reviews. Logs and returns all eligible medications to the pharmacy in a timely manner. If facility directed, assumes responsibility for Medicare residents by attending weekly Medicare meetings and assuring that certifications are completed. Attends meetings appropriately including but not limited to Fall Risk, Restraint, Wound Care, and Weight Loss meetings. Assumes any other duties as assigned by DNS/ADNS. Performs other related duties and attends meetings as may be deemed necessary by Supervisor / Administrator and or Director.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S ⦁ Administers medication and treatments according to the physician's orders. ⦁ Assumes responsibility for ordering medications. ⦁ Transcribes, documents, and implements physician's orders. ⦁ Collects data to assist in the nursing assessments during each shift. ⦁ Gives daily shift report to CNAs assigned to the unit prior to the start of the shift. ⦁ Reviews written daily assignments for each resident on assigned unit. ⦁ Assures assignments are completed before the end of the shift. ⦁ Gives and takes nursing report on assigned unit. Communicates essential information to appropriate parties. ⦁ Makes rounds on assigned residents at least once every two hours. ⦁ Collaborates with Care Plan Coordinator to develop and maintain nursing care plans and update these plans on a regular basis and as the resident's condition changes. ⦁ Attends and participates in interdisciplinary resident care conferences as requested. ⦁ Assists the attending physician with rounds and special procedures as needed. ⦁ Participates in the yearly written evaluations of nursing assistants and documents accurately their strengths, weaknesses and the steps that need to be taken to improve their performance. ⦁ Assists Staff Development with orientation and on-the-job training for new nursing personnel as needed. ⦁ Collaborates with nursing supervisor in documenting disciplinary concerns for nursing assistants on designated shifts, including reprimands, oral and written warnings, and corrective action recommendations. ⦁ Notifies nursing supervisor, resident’s physician, and family of a change in the resident’s condition or an accident/incident involving the resident. ⦁ Assumes any duties that are assigned by the RN Supervisor/ADNS to provide optimal quality resident care. ⦁ Performs other related duties and attends meetings as may be deemed necessary by Supervisor / Administrator and or Director. Functions · Assists in ambulation and transfers from and to bed, toilet, chair, stretcher. · Assists or feeds resident(s) as indicated, serves water and nourishment. · Offers and removes bedpans and/or urinals · Keeps incontinent resident clean and dry, changes linens and makes beds. Replaces towels and wash cloths. · Gives bed baths, tub baths, and provides skin care. Provides care of hair and oral hygiene. · Assists residents to dress and undress · Takes part of bowel and bladder rehabilitation program of the resident · Collects specimens and measures intake and output and keeps records of the same · Takes temperature, pulse, and respiration. May prepare ice packs or other resident care equipment when directed to do so by the Nurse in charge. · Observes residents and notes physical condition, attitude, reactions, appetites, and reports changes or unusual findings to the Charge Nurse responsible for reporting for reporting resident complaints to the Nurse or Supervisors. · Before getting off duty, signs the aide book kept at the nurse's station · Attends regularly scheduled in-service classes as required by HOME and MASAOH regulations. · Cleans equipment (carbonized beds, stands, etc.) as directed by the nurse.
